Hey,

I've got a Netgear WG311 v3 Wireless PCI card, and the other day I restarted my computer, now the device manager says the device cannot start and it simply doesn't work. I've tried uninstalling/reinstalling to no avail. Sometimes when I boot up, the device will start but will just hang when trying to find wireless networks, other times it will just say device cannot start. Is there anything i'm forgetting to try?? I would like to try it in another computer but thats not an option at the moment, and it's getting annoying having to do everything with my laptop!

Thanks in advance,

Matt
 
Take it out and put it back in. That happened to me once. Make sure Window's wireless connection is off. You may have accidentally enabled it. The 2 would conflict.

Tried that last night, actually I swapped it to another PCI slot, still didn't work. Now this is the annoying thing, I added some new RAM about 2 weeks ago, but one of them failed on me today, so I took it out...booted up and BAM, wireless works again. Bit weird eh, but it's working perfectly now!
